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$942 in Ryazan versus $1,047 in Novosibirsk.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,413 in Ryazan versus $1,703 in Novosibirsk.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,884 in Ryazan versus $2,359 in Novosibirsk.

Living in Ryazan costs roughly 10% less than in Novosibirsk,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.

Both cities sit below the global median: Ryazan 31% lower, Novosibirsk 24%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$500 in Ryazan and $515 in Novosibirsk.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Ryazan pays 38% more on average while also being the cheaper of the two. The combined effect is a noticeably stronger local purchasing power.

Dining out: $35.00 in Ryazan vs $41.00 in Novosibirsk for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$202 vs $205 per month, with Ryazan cheaper across the board.
